Just checked my balance and my gold bonus is not quite what I was hoping for.

I flew UC to BOM which is 8938 miles including the UC 200% bonus, however I was awarded 2235 bonus miles. Do they base it off the milage, or the milage + cabin bonus? I called VS last night and the nice woman at the end of the phone was equally confused by the rules and promised to call back.
#104804 by mcuth
10 Mar 2006, 12:42
Originally posted by Ongen
Do they base it off the milage, or the milage + cabin bonus?


50% of base mileage only (i.e. not including the cabin bonus) per leg - you might want to have a look at this FAQ for a base mileage table.
